Top 10 remote control crawler flail mulcher manufacturers in China
Built for Challenging TerrainVigorun’s remote-controlled crawler mower is engineered with a reinforced rubber track chassis, ensuring reliable traction and stability…
Built for Challenging TerrainVigorun’s remote-controlled crawler mower is engineered with a reinforced rubber track chassis, ensuring reliable traction and stability…